Day 5 of The Shiva Reset teaches you the art of "System Cooling." Inspired by the image of Shiva as Chandrashekhara, who wears the crescent moon on his head to cool his fiery energy, this meditation uses a powerful technique called "Lunar Breathing" (Chandra Bhedana). We will manually lower your body temperature and heart rate, flushing cortisol from your system, and preparing you for deep, restorative sleep. It is not just a nap; it is an engineering reset.

Today's teaching comes from an old,

Beautiful legend.

It is said the moon,

Cursed to fade away,

Sought refuge in Shiva.

Its light was dying,

And with it the world's coolness and peace.

Shiva,

In boundless compassion,

Did not remove the curse.

He placed the weakening moon on his own forehead.

Against his knotted hair,

The moon's decay stopped.

It found a permanent home.

Its gentle light now cooling the immense fire of Shiva's own meditation.

This is the teaching.

Our own energy can become a furious,

Exhausting fire.

Our minds can feel like they are wasting away under pressure.

Chandrasekhara shows us the way.

We don't fight the exhaustion.

We don't deny the fire.

We bring the cooling,

Soothing quality of awareness,

The Soma,

The Nectar,

Directly to it.

We offer our tired minds refuge in the infinite space of our own consciousness.

In that refuge,

Exhaustion finds a rhythm.

Burnout transforms into a sacred balance.
